Jacks or Better – Power Poker Overview

At its core, Jacks or Better – Power Poker keeps the straightforward appeal that fans of classic poker appreciate—you aim to form a hand with at least a pair of jacks to secure a win. But Flip Five Gaming turns up the thrill by letting you play several hands at once, giving you more opportunities to hit it big! The interface is sleek and easy to navigate, so you won’t miss a beat while managing multiple hands.

What really sets this game apart is its Power Poker feature, which allows you to play up to four hands simultaneously. This not only boosts your chances of winning but also introduces a layer of strategy that distinguishes it from standard video poker. The stakes are high, and the fun factor gets a lift with the Double Up gamble option. After every win, you can try to double your payout in a classic side bet that could multiply your rewards if luck is on your side. But be cautious—one wrong move could wipe out your earnings instantly!
